OHRRPGCE ypsiliform stable release
The Ypsiliform stable release is official today! If you haven't been following the nightly wip builds, and want to know what is new and cool, <a href="http://hamsterrepublic.com/ohrrpgce/wha ... new.txt</a> has the glorious details.
Get it from the <a href="http://gilgamesh.hamsterrepublic.com/wi ... ">download page</a>

The ability to hold down the key and use multiple items has always been there, and is intentional. But I should slow down the key-repeat.
As for the flicker when using healing items outside of battle, that one is a side effect of a rewrite of the out-of-battle targeting code. It was super messy and bug-prone, now it is nice and clean... but has that flicker :)
I'll probably be able to get rid of the flicker without too much trouble, but it didn't seem important enough to stress about at the time.
